Unique Antique Engagement Ring Circa 1910
The Molly ring is an Edwardian earring circa 1910 that has more recently been converted to a ring! The ring centers an east-west set old marquise cut diamond weighing approximately 0.48 carats of light brown color, SI2 clarity. The diamond is in a platinum bezel setting. Above (or below, depending on which way you wear the ring) is a 0.32 carat old mine cut diamond set in a 6 prong platinum setting. There are 4 additional old cut diamonds asymmetrically set throughout the ring. The band is 18 karat yellow gold. The ring is size 7.5 and can be resized.
